Shawn Johnson is a retired American artistic gymnast who won balance beam gold at the Beijing Olympic Games. Introduced to gymnastics at the age of three, she plunged into gymnastics full-time to become a professional gymnast. Shawn Johnson started competing in national junior events at the age of 12 and was a part of various national and international events as a senior, winning a number of titles. She is a three-time holder of US all-around championship—once as a junior and twice as a senior. By winning gold in the all-around competition in 2007 World Championship in Stuttguart, she became the fourth American woman to claim a World Championship title in the event. Besides, she also bagged the world title in floor exercise. As a 16-year old rising star, she went on to rule the world of gymnastics by striking gold in the balance beam event at the 2008 Summer Olympics, held in Beijing. Further, she also won silver in team, all-around and floor events at the Beijing Olympics. She has been honored with numerous awards for her contribution to gymnastics. She was crowned the winner of ‘Dancing with the Stars’ season eight in 2009 and finished second in its all-star edition in 2012
